So we're out...

Dutch football hero Ruud van Nistelrooij looks into the camera during our national anthem. I didn't go to Switzerland to take this pic, I was sitting at home on the couch, watching the game and taking a screen shot with my new Kodak EasyShare Z1012 IS camera.
I haven't been blogging for a while, because I was too busy living my life :-) And of course I wanted to see the games with our great orange football team. The Dutch did well during the first round, beating Italy (3-0), France (3-1) and Romania (2-0) and finishing on top of the 'group of death'. But a great team from Russia, coached by Guus Hiddink from the Netherlands (thank you, Guus) kicked us out of the tournament yesterday and I have to admit they really deserved to win. So: come on, Russia!
I like football, but I am not as mad as some of my neighbours (see picture below).
The day after the night before...

Now I am hoping that the Russians will win the European Championships. But Spain and Turkey have great teams too. We all know of course that Italy or Germany will have the last laugh - as always. Playing bad games but winning tournaments is also a quality, I guess.
